She was the daughter of Owen and Elizabeth (Evans) James and the fourth wife of Walter Camp.
Margaret was previously married to Eugene Gise; she used the Gise name on her Camp marriage application.
Birth and death information taken from California Death Index. Buried in Forest Lawn Memorial Park, Cypress, Orange Co., CA

Obituary from 3 Feb 1949 edition of Hartford Courant:
"Mrs. Margaret James Camp, 57, widow of Walter Camp, Jr., Businessman and son of the famous Yale coach, died yesterday. Mrs. Camp, born at Hollidaysburg, Pa., had lived here for the last 12 years. She was director of arts and skills for the Los Angeles Red Cross and trustee and secretary of the Modern Institute of Art, Beverly Hills. She leaves a stepson, Walter Camp, 3rd, of New York."
